Culture Media and Sport written question – answered at on 30 June 2014.
To ask the Secretary of State for Culture, Media and Sport what progress he has made on improving the availability of superfast broadband in (a) the Thames Valley and (b) Windsor constituency.

Ofcom monitors and reports on broadband and the table is of Next Generation Access availability across Berkshire between 2012 and 2013:
Percentage | ||
Local authorities | 2012 | 2013 |
Bracknell Forest | 76.8 | 96.2 |
Reading | 92.9 | 95.0 |
Slough | 91.7 | 96.6 |
West Berkshire | 59.5 | 65.1 |
Windsor and Maidenhead | 83.1 | 89.7 |
Wokingham | 87.3 | 92.5 |
Berkshire | 81.7 | 88.5 |
